- Global Narcissism vs. Global Warming "Through the metaphor of 'global narcissism' this paper explores how humanity’s response to ecological crisis mirrors narcissistic defense mechanisms and suggests a collapse is taking place." By @hopeforfuture1.bsky.social Open Access: doi.org/10.1177/2053...
- [Not loaded yet]
- “Since narcissism is linked to fragile self-identity, policies should emphasize messaging that does not trigger defensive responses. This means shifting climate narratives from blame and guilt toward empowerment, interconnectedness, and the benefits of adaptation.” #SocialPsyc 🌍🧪
